OData描述语言

时间:2012-01-03 09:50:41

标签: wcf odata edmx csdl

我想知道edmx / csdl优于wsdl 2.0和wadl的优势是微软已经为OData选择了它。有什么想法吗?

1 个答案:

答案 0 :(得分:-1)

WSDL 2.0或WADL都未被全球接受。 MS不接受他们中的任何一个。

MS描述OData服务的方式不是很幸运,但它是MS策略。他们将大量资源投入到EDM(实体数据模型)中,他们现在到处推动它以满足他们的投资需求。 EDMX只是将EDM序列化为XML的一种方法。 CSDL是EDMX的一部分,用于描述概念模型=类,MS工具(WCF数据服务)使用它来为您预生成客户端代码。